During his last 19 months on Earth, Pope Francis continually condemned the US enabled Israeli genocide in Gaza and demanded its end
Since it began shortly after the October 7, 2023 Hamas attack, Francis called Gaza’s Holy Family Parish nightly inquiring of their wellbeing.
But he also publicly implored the purveyors of genocide to stop. Last January he demanded “We cannot in any way accept the bombing of civilians … that children are freezing to death because hospitals have been destroyed.”
A few weeks earlier he pondered aloud whether Israel’s military campaign amounted to genocide. Israel responded by accusing Francis of antisemitism. No surprise there.
On April 3, 2024 Francis condemned Israeli killing of aid workers. He called for an investigation into the unfolding genocide in Gaza, urging the world not to look away from the suffering of its people. “I am thinking above all of those who leave Gaza in the midst of the famine that has struck their Palestinian brothers and sisters given the difficulty of getting food and aid into their territory,”
Francis spoke out against Israeli to the end. Just a few hours before dying, he delivered his Urbi et Orbi message—“to the city and to the world” focusing on the Holy Land, calling it “wounded by conflict and gripped by endless of violence.” He expressed solidarity with the Muslim and Christian community where “the terrible conflict continues to cause death and destruction and to create a dramatic and deplorable humanitarian situation. “I appeal once again for an immediate ceasefire in the Gaza Strip”.
